Early years organisations, experts and consultants are worried that Government proposals on changes to early years qualifications, outlined in a consultation launched today, could lower standards and ultimately, the quality of care.

The plans on changes to qualifications and ratios being consulted on include:

  • Only requiring managers to hold a maths qualification rather than all Level 3 practitioners.
  • Introducing an ‘experience based route’ to gain ‘approved status’ without having to do a qualification.
  • Changing the percentage of Level 2 qualified staff required for staff: child ratios by altering the requirement that ‘at least half of all other staff must hold an approved Level 2 qualification’. The percentage could be changed to either 30 or 40 per cent to provide settings with ‘greater flexibility’.
